在线FLV播放器实现方法
随着互联网技术的快速发展,在线视频播放已经成为我们日常生活中不可或缺的一部分。然而,如何实现一个稳定且高效的在线FLV(Flash Video)播放器,仍然是许多开发者需要解决的问题。本文将详细介绍在线FLV播放器的实现方法,帮助开发者更好地理解和构建这一功能。
首先,要实现一个在线FLV播放器,我们需要了解FLV文件的基本结构和特性。FLV是一种流媒体文件格式,广泛用于网络视频传输。它支持音频、视频和元数据的存储,并且可以通过Adobe Flash Player进行播放。因此,选择合适的播放器插件是实现在线FLV播放的关键。
其次,为了确保播放器的兼容性和稳定性,建议使用HTML5的`
在具体实现过程中,有几个关键步骤需要注意。首先是视频文件的加载和解析。由于FLV文件通常较大,直接加载可能会导致延迟或卡顿。因此,建议采用分段加载的方式,即将视频文件分割成多个小片段,按需加载并播放。其次是音视频同步问题,这需要精确的时间戳管理,以确保播放流畅无误。
此外,为了提升用户体验,还可以添加一些高级功能,如全屏播放、字幕支持、多分辨率切换等。这些功能不仅能够丰富播放体验,还能提高用户的满意度。
最后,测试和优化是必不可少的环节。在不同的设备和网络环境下进行充分的测试,可以帮助发现潜在的问题并及时调整。同时,持续关注最新的技术和标准更新,也是保持播放器竞争力的重要手段。
总之,实现一个在线FLV播放器需要综合考虑技术细节、用户体验和性能优化等多个方面。通过合理的设计和开发,我们可以为用户提供一个高效、稳定的视频播放解决方案。
希望这篇文章能满足您的需求,如果有任何进一步的要求或修改意见,请随时告知!